BUFFALO, N.Y. -- Buffalo Sabres top-line center Jack Eichel is out indefinitely after being diagnosed with a high ankle sprain on Wednesday.The Sabres provided the update hours after Eichel was hurt in the teams final practice before it opens the regular season hosting Montreal on Thursday.As of now, no timetable has been set for his return, the team posted on its Twitter account.Eichel was in front of the net when he got tangled up with a defenseman and his leg buckled beneath him .He lay on the ice and grabbed his leg in pain as the team circled around him. Eichel was unable to put any weight on his leg as teammates helped him off the ice.The injury occurred with less than 10 minutes remaining in practice, Bylsma said.Its the cusp and eve of starting a new season, one we are all looking forward too, and I think thats why it takes the wind out of the sails of the arena today, coach Dan Bylsma said.Eichel is key to the Sabres future after being selected with the No. 2 pick in the 2015 draft. He is coming off a solid rookie season in which he had 24 goals and 32 assists for 56 points in 81 games last year.Eichel played one year at Boston University and became the second freshman to win college hockeys top honor, the Hobey Baker Award.You expect to have to deal with injuries throughout the year, Bylsma said. Its one we are going to have to deal with, whatever the extent of the situation is. Our team is not just Jack Eichel, its not just Ryan OReilly.OReilly, the Sabres captain, participated in his first full practice Wednesday since he experienced muscle spasms during his preseason debut last week. He looked good out there, Bylsma said.Forward Kyle Okposo did not practice due to a bruised knee. Balsam said he expects Okposo to participate in a morning skate Thursday, but he is unlikely to play in the opener.Okposo signed a seven-year, $42 million contract with the Sabres in July after eight seasons with the New York Islanders, becoming Buffalos second-highest-paid player, after OReilly, who signed a seven-year, $52 million deal shortly after being acquired in a trade from Colorado last summer. MONTREAL -- Stephane Waite, who helped shape goaltenders Corey Crawford and Antti Niemi for the Stanley Cup champion Chicago Blackhawks, was named goaltending coach of the Montreal Canadiens on Thursday. Waite replaces Pierre Groulx, who was let go at the end of the season. He had been goalie coach in Chicago for 10 years, during which the Blackhawks won two Cups. "Stephane Waite has over 30 years of experience as a goaltending coach," Canadiens general manager Marc Bergevin, who worked in the Blackhawks front office before joining Montreal last season, said in a statement. "He contributed to two Stanley Cup championships with the Blackhawks during his tenure working closely with two different goaltenders, namely Antti Niemi and Corey Crawford. In Montreal, Waite will work with veterans Carey Price and Peter Budaj. The team also picked up Halifax Mooseheads goalie Zach Fucale in the draft on Sunday. This season, the brother of former NHL goaltender Jimmy Waite helped Crawford and Ray Emery win the Jennings Trophy awarded to the goalies with the best goals-against average in the NHL. In his career, Waite has served as goaltender respresentative for Sherbrooke Hockey and was goaltending consultant for IMG Hockey. The Sherbrooke, Que., native also coached goalies for several junior and midget AAA teams in the 1980s and 1990s and has run his own goaltending camp since 1988. Other NHL goalies he has worked with include Craig Anderson, Nikolai Khabibulin, Jocelyn Thibault, Brian Boucher, Felix Potvin, Jean-Sebastien Aubin, Michael Leighton, Patrick Lalime, Cristobal Huet and Marty Turco.
